>> I wonder if some of you who installed iOS 8 on a 4S or for that matter 
>> on any iDevice follow a few simple pre-install steps:
>> 
>> 
>> 
>> 1.       If you use iTunes, connect your phone, transfer purchases, sync
> and
>> backup.
>> 
>> 2.       Now remove all apps from the app switcher
>> 
>> 3.       Go to Settings, General, Reset and double tap "Reset Network
>> Settings". This will reset your network setting to the factory default 
>> and reboot your phone. You will have to connect to your WiFi again and 
>> enter your password after the phone reboots.
>> 
>> 4.       Now do your update to iOS 8.

>> Hello folks,
>> 
>> It looks that a very important function has been totally disabled with
>> iOS8 on the 4s.  The holding on the second tap to remove apps and 
>> folders no longer works.  This is a very serious bug that disabled a 
>> very crucial function.  Now, if you install apps, you can't remove 
>> them.  I am not sure if this is a problem specific to iOS8 on the 4S, 
>> a problem specific to my own device in a strike of bad luck, or a 
>> worldwide problem on all versions of the iPhones with iOS8.  Can you 
>> please confirm this problem or tell me how to go around it if it is
> particular to my device?
